Connect the printer to
your Macintosh and
install the driver
a
Connect the network interface cable to the LAN
connector marked with a
symbol and then
connect it to a free port on your hub.
b
Make sure the printer power switch is on.
c
Turn on your Macintosh. Put the supplied CD-
ROM into your CD-ROM drive.
d
Double-click the
Start Here OSX
icon. Follow
the on-screen instructions.
e
Follow the on-screen instructions until this
screen appears. Choose your machine from
the list, and then click
OK
.
f
When this screen appears, click
Next
.
Note
It may take a few minutes for installation to
complete.
Note
If there is more than one of the same model
connected on your network, the MAC Address
(Ethernet Address) will be displayed after the
model name.
You can find your machine’s MAC Address
(Ethernet Address) and IP Address by printing
out the Printer Settings Page. See
Print the
Printer Settings Page
on page 16.
Note
When the
Brother Support
screen appears,
make your selection and follow the on-screen
instructions.
Finish
The installation is now
complete.
Note
If you use a specified IP Address for the machine,
you must set the Boot Method to Static by using
the BRAdmin Light. For more information, See
Configuring your machine for a network
in the
Network User’s Guide.
